diff --git a/package.json b/package.json index 848f44b..e9a4ba6 100644 --- a/package.json +++ b/package.json @@ -63,7 +63,7 @@ "react-native-gesture-handler": "~2.28.0", "react-native-reanimated": "~4.1.6", "react-native-safe-area-context": "~5.6.2", - "react-native-screens": "~4.16.0", + "react-native-screens": "~4.19.0", "react-native-svg": "15.12.1", "react-native-video": "^6.18.0", "react-native-web": "^0.21.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 95a0bfd..70d4d40 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-28,7 +28,7 @@ importers: version: 12.4.0(react-native-tvos@0.81.5-1)(react@19.1.0) '@react-navigation/drawer': specifier: ^7.5.0 - version: 7.7.9(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-gesture-handler@2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-reanimated@4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) + version: 7.7.9(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-gesture-handler@2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-reanimated@4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@react-navigation/native': specifier: ^7.1.6 version: 7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0) @@ -82,7 +82,7 @@ importers: version: 17.0.8(expo@54.0.30)(react@19.1.0) expo-router: specifier: ~6.0.21 - version: 6.0.21(3aecbe9d7ed07872f1130e15ea243a1f) + version: 6.0.21(3d38501e8685d9497d77fec5beab3e55) expo-splash-screen: specifier: ~31.0.13 version: 31.0.13(expo@54.0.30) @@ -120,8 +120,8 @@ importers: specifier: ~5.6.2 version: 5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-screens: - specifier: ~4.16.0 - version: 4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0) + specifier: ~4.19.0 + version: 4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-svg: specifier: 15.12.1 version: 15.12.1(react-native-tvos@0.81.5-1)(react@19.1.0) @@ -4255,8 +4255,8 @@ packages: react: '*' react-native: '*' - react-native-screens@4.16.0: - resolution: {integrity: sha512-yIAyh7F/9uWkOzCi1/2FqvNvK6Wb9Y1+Kzn16SuGfN9YFJDTbwlzGRvePCNTOX0recpLQF3kc2FmvMUhyTCH1Q==} + react-native-screens@4.19.0: + resolution: {integrity: sha512-qSDAO3AL5bti0Ri7KZRSVmWlhDr8MV86N5GruiKVQfEL7Zx2nUi3Dl62lqHUAD/LnDvOPuDDsMHCfIpYSv3hPQ==} peerDependencies: react: '*' react-native: '*' @@ -5028,6 +5028,7 @@ packages: whatwg-encoding@2.0.0: resolution: {integrity: sha512-p41ogyeMUrw3jWclHWTQg1k05DSVXPLcVxRTYsXUk+ZooOCZLcoYgPZ/HL/D/N+uQPOtcp1me1WhBEaX02mhWg==} engines: {node: '>=12'} + deprecated: Use @exodus/bytes instead for a more spec-conformant and faster implementation whatwg-fetch@3.6.20: resolution: {integrity: sha512-EqhiFU6daOA8kpjOWTL0olhVOF3i7OrFzSYiGsEMB8GcXS+RrzauAERX65xMeNWVqxA6HXH2m69Z9LaKKdisfg==} @@ -5955,7 +5956,7 @@ snapshots: wrap-ansi: 7.0.0 ws: 8.18.3 optionalDependencies: - expo-router: 6.0.21(3aecbe9d7ed07872f1130e15ea243a1f) + expo-router: 6.0.21(3d38501e8685d9497d77fec5beab3e55) react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) transitivePeerDependencies: - bufferutil @@ -6862,7 +6863,7 @@ snapshots: '@react-native/normalize-colors@0.81.5': {} - '@react-navigation/bottom-tabs@7.8.12(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0)': + '@react-navigation/bottom-tabs@7.8.12(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0)': dependencies: '@react-navigation/elements': 2.9.2(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@react-navigation/native': 7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0) @@ -6870,7 +6871,7 @@ snapshots: react: 19.1.0 react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-safe-area-context: 5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0) - react-native-screens: 4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0) + react-native-screens: 4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0) sf-symbols-typescript: 2.2.0 transitivePeerDependencies: - '@react-native-masked-view/masked-view' @@ -6887,7 +6888,7 @@ snapshots: use-latest-callback: 0.2.6(react@19.1.0) use-sync-external-store: 1.6.0(react@19.1.0) - '@react-navigation/drawer@7.7.9(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-gesture-handler@2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-reanimated@4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0)': + '@react-navigation/drawer@7.7.9(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-gesture-handler@2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-reanimated@4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0)': dependencies: '@react-navigation/elements': 2.9.2(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@react-navigation/native': 7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0) @@ -6898,7 +6899,7 @@ snapshots: react-native-gesture-handler: 2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-reanimated: 4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0) react-native-safe-area-context: 5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0) - react-native-screens: 4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0) + react-native-screens: 4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0) use-latest-callback: 0.2.6(react@19.1.0) transitivePeerDependencies: - '@react-native-masked-view/masked-view' @@ -6913,7 +6914,7 @@ snapshots: use-latest-callback: 0.2.6(react@19.1.0) use-sync-external-store: 1.6.0(react@19.1.0) - '@react-navigation/native-stack@7.8.6(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0)': + '@react-navigation/native-stack@7.8.6(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0)': dependencies: '@react-navigation/elements': 2.9.2(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@react-navigation/native': 7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0) @@ -6921,7 +6922,7 @@ snapshots: react: 19.1.0 react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-safe-area-context: 5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0) - react-native-screens: 4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0) + react-native-screens: 4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0) sf-symbols-typescript: 2.2.0 warn-once: 0.1.1 transitivePeerDependencies: @@ -8459,15 +8460,15 @@ snapshots: react: 19.1.0 react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) - expo-router@6.0.21(3aecbe9d7ed07872f1130e15ea243a1f): + expo-router@6.0.21(3d38501e8685d9497d77fec5beab3e55): dependencies: '@expo/metro-runtime': 6.1.2(expo@54.0.30)(react-dom@19.1.0(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@expo/schema-utils': 0.1.8 '@radix-ui/react-slot': 1.2.0(@types/react@19.1.17)(react@19.1.0) '@radix-ui/react-tabs': 1.1.13(@types/react@19.1.17)(react-dom@19.1.0(react@19.1.0))(react@19.1.0) - '@react-navigation/bottom-tabs': 7.8.12(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) + '@react-navigation/bottom-tabs': 7.8.12(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@react-navigation/native': 7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0) - '@react-navigation/native-stack': 7.8.6(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) + '@react-navigation/native-stack': 7.8.6(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) client-only: 0.0.1 debug: 4.4.3 escape-string-regexp: 4.0.0 @@ -8484,7 +8485,7 @@ snapshots: react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-is-edge-to-edge: 1.2.1(react-native-tvos@0.81.5-1)(react@19.1.0) react-native-safe-area-context: 5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0) - react-native-screens: 4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0) + react-native-screens: 4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0) semver: 7.6.3 server-only: 0.0.1 sf-symbols-typescript: 2.2.0 @@ -8492,7 +8493,7 @@ snapshots: use-latest-callback: 0.2.6(react@19.1.0) vaul: 1.1.2(@types/react@19.1.17)(react-dom@19.1.0(react@19.1.0))(react@19.1.0) optionalDependencies: - '@react-navigation/drawer': 7.7.9(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-gesture-handler@2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-reanimated@4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) + '@react-navigation/drawer': 7.7.9(@react-navigation/native@7.1.25(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-gesture-handler@2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-reanimated@4.1.6(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react-native-worklets@0.5.1(@babel/core@7.28.5)(react-native-tvos@0.81.5-1)(react@19.1.0))(react@19.1.0))(react-native-safe-area-context@5.6.2(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0))(react-native-tvos@0.81.5-1)(react@19.1.0) '@testing-library/react-native': 13.3.3(jest@29.7.0(@types/node@25.0.0))(react-native-tvos@0.81.5-1)(react-test-renderer@19.1.0(react@19.1.0))(react@19.1.0) react-dom: 19.1.0(react@19.1.0) react-native-gesture-handler: 2.28.0(react-native-tvos@0.81.5-1)(react@19.1.0) @@ -10342,12 +10343,11 @@ snapshots: react: 19.1.0 react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) - react-native-screens@4.16.0(react-native-tvos@0.81.5-1)(react@19.1.0): + react-native-screens@4.19.0(react-native-tvos@0.81.5-1)(react@19.1.0): dependencies: react: 19.1.0 react-freeze: 1.0.4(react@19.1.0) react-native: react-native-tvos@0.81.5-1(@babel/core@7.28.5)(@types/react@19.1.17)(react-native-tvos@0.81.5-1)(react@19.1.0) - react-native-is-edge-to-edge: 1.2.1(react-native-tvos@0.81.5-1)(react@19.1.0) warn-once: 0.1.1 react-native-svg@15.12.1(react-native-tvos@0.81.5-1)(react@19.1.0):